Short description of the contract or purchase(s)
In April 2014, Velindre NHS Trust - the Contracting Authority (acting on behalf of the NHS Wales bodies listed in section VI.3 of this notice)- awarded a framework agreement for the services listed below (the “Framework Agreement”). The Framework Agreement and associated ancillary procurement documentation made provision for a refresh of the Framework Agreement [18 months’] after signature. Accordingly, the Contracting Authority is now seeking to refresh the Framework Agreement by:
(a) inviting potential new service providers to tender for appointment onto the existing Framework Agreement; and
(b) to allow existing service providers appointed to the existing Framework Agreement to amend/expand their service offering by being able to refresh their prices upwards or downwards (subject to a sustainable financial appraisal) and to apply to add new sites/units/facilities to their service offering.. The scope of the services being procured, which are separated into lots, are as follows:
-Medium Secure Learning Disability - Male
-Medium Secure Learning Disability - Female
-Medium Secure Mental Health - Male
-Medium Secure Mental Health - Female
-Low Secure Learning Disability – Male
-Low Secure Learning Disability - Female
-Low Secure Mental Health - Male
-Low Secure Mental Health – Female
-Locked Rehabilitation (Controlled Egress) Mental Health – Male
-Locked Rehabilitation (Controlled Egress) Mental Health - Female
-Locked Rehabilitation (Controlled Egress) Learning Disability - Male
-Locked Rehabilitation (Controlled Egress) Learning Disability- Female
-Open Rehabilitation (Uncontrolled Egress) Mental Health – Male
-Open Rehabilitation (Uncontrolled Egress) Mental Health - Female
-Open Rehabilitation (Uncontrolled Egress) Learning Disability - Male
-Open Rehabilitation (Uncontrolled Egress) Learning Disability- Female
The duration of the existing Framework Agreement is for an initial period of four (4) years from 1st April 2014 with an option to extend, at the Contracting Authority's sole discretion, for an additional period of up to two (2) years (in 12 month tranches).
Current service providers who have been appointed to the Framework Agreement are not required to respond to this advert.
Further information is set out in a Pre-Qualification Questionnaire (PQQ) and Project Information Memorandum (POI) which is available on request (see section VI.3 of this notice for details)
